In our modern society, most families have both parents working. In single parent families, the solitary parent has no choice but to work. But..who looks after the children?

Parents looking for day care for their children have not many choices;

1.) Stay home and look after the children 2.) Work when your partner is home to look after the kids (Now there is a recipe for a short relationship!) 3.) Put the children into a crche, kindergarten or playgroup during working hours 4.) Find a live-in Nanny 5.) Look for a childminder 6.) Hit on brothers, sisters and parents to take care of the kids

Staying at home with the children sounds a great idea in the beginning, but then you soon realize that you cannot afford the most basic luxury items that your children want. “Other kids have them, why can’t I?” is the typical refrain. Adults as well require other adult conversation that is not about kids, and work is the place where this is most effortlessly found.

I know people who have attempted option 2, with one partner working days and the other nights. Do not even go there. Love life? Forget it, your relationship will shortly be in tatters.

Crche, kindergarten and playgroup child supervision is extremely expensive. Many parents find that over half of their wages go in paying the childcare fees for the week. Governments are progressively coming to realize that they need to do something to give tax breaks to parents to go some way to paying their child day care fees. Or else nobody will have kids and who is going to pay the pensions of all those retired government employees and politicians.

Live-in Nanny? Well au pair then. Au pairs can still be located, but are notoriously hard to rely on, and with bad cases in the press, this choice is fading away to zero for many parents.

Childminders look after your kids in the childminder’s home. All you’ve got to do is drop them off and pick them up again. Locating a childminder with the same outlook to your own on child rearing is difficult. Problems also come up when the childminder is sick or wants to have a vacation. The largest childminder troubles come to the fore when your child is ill. “She is unwell, is she? Sorry you cannot leave her here then till she’s much better again” is essentially what you’ll hear.

Finding relatives to take care of your kids may be challenging, unless you have a turn and turn about arrangement that allows both sets of parents the opportunity for paid employment.
